Your Employment Rights
10 rights & entitlements
As a veteran you have the same employment rights as any UK worker — plus additional protections under the Equality Act if you have a service-related condition, and access to specialist transition and employer schemes.
Housing Rights
8 rights & entitlements
Veterans have enhanced rights when applying for social housing, specialist homelessness pathways, and practical help from military charities.
Healthcare Entitlements
9 rights & entitlements
Veterans can access priority NHS treatment for service-related conditions, specialist mental health services, trauma networks and welfare support — often without a long GP wait for the first step.
Financial Support & Benefits
10 rights & entitlements
Compensation schemes, disability benefits, pensions and discounts can make a major difference — but rules differ depending on when you served and how you were injured.
Education, Training & Skills
6 rights & entitlements
Learning credits, resettlement training, apprenticeships and further education routes help convert service skills into civilian qualifications.
Money, Debt & Practical Support
6 rights & entitlements
Practical help with debt, budgeting, discounts and day-to-day money pressures — including when compensation or pensions make benefits forms confusing.
Support for Families
6 rights & entitlements
Spouses, partners, children and bereaved families have their own routes to work, education, healthcare and welfare support under the Covenant.
Covenant, Community & Legal Rights
6 rights & entitlements
Public bodies have Covenant duties, and veterans can expect fair treatment from councils, health, education and justice services — plus community hubs and legal advice routes.

Veterans mental health — free specialist routes

If you are a veteran, reservist or family member, you can use national crisis lines and services built for service-related trauma. These sit in your Healthcare rights as well — this is the short version.

Op COURAGE (NHS)

Free specialist mental health for veterans. Self-refer — no GP needed.

nhs.uk/opcourage

Or call 111 and ask for the veteran pathway

Combat Stress

Specialist PTSD support. Helpline free 24/7.

0800 138 1619

Text COMBAT STRESS to 85258

Samaritans

Anyone can call — free, 24/7, confidential.

116 123
